function section7_statisticalMethods() {
|
||||
return [
|
||||
h1('7. Statistical Methods'),
|
||||
para('All quantitative claims are supported by appropriate statistical tests. We do not report point estimates without confidence intervals.'),
|
||||
emptyLine(),
|
||||
h3('7.1 Bootstrap Confidence Intervals'),
|
||||
bullet('All metrics (Precision@k, MRR, Recall@10, nDCG@10) are reported with bootstrap 95% CI.'),
|
||||
bullet('Method: 10,000 bootstrap resamples of the 100-query test set.'),
|
||||
bullet('A metric "meets threshold" only if the lower bound of the 95% CI exceeds the threshold.'),
|
||||
emptyLine(),
|
||||
h3('7.2 Permutation Tests for Baseline Comparisons'),
|
||||
bullet('Null hypothesis: Waggle and baseline have equal Precision@5 (H0: delta = 0).'),
|
||||
bullet('Method: 10,000 random label permutations between Waggle and baseline scores.'),
|
||||
bullet('Significance level: p < 0.05 (two-tailed).'),
|
||||
bullet('Effect size: Cohen\'s d reported alongside p-value.'),
|
||||
emptyLine(),
|
||||
h3('7.3 Per-Domain Breakdown'),
|
||||
bullet('All metrics are computed globally AND per domain (research, code, business, personal).'),
|
||||
bullet('Domain-level results identify systematic weaknesses (e.g., "code queries underperform").'),
|
||||
bullet('Domain imbalance is mitigated by equal query allocation (25 per domain).'),
|
||||
emptyLine(),
|
||||
h3('7.4 Multiple Comparisons Correction'),
|
||||
bullet('When comparing against 5 baselines, Bonferroni correction is applied: alpha_adj = 0.05 / 5 = 0.01.'),
|
||||
bullet('A baseline comparison is significant only at p < 0.01 after correction.'),
|
||||
pageBreak(),
|
||||
];
|
||||
}

function section8_riskMitigation() {
|
||||
return [
|
||||
h1('8. Risk Mitigation'),
|
||||
para('The following table identifies foreseeable risks and pre-planned responses. No risk is acceptable without a mitigation plan.'),
|
||||
emptyLine(),
|
||||
makeTable(
|
||||
['Risk', 'Likelihood', 'Impact', 'Mitigation'],
|
||||
[
|
||||
[
|
||||
'Retrieval scores below threshold',
|
||||
'Medium',
|
||||
'High',
|
||||
'Diagnose per-domain: if one domain drags the average, tune scoring profile weights for that domain. If systemic, investigate embedding quality (switch provider or re-embed with higher-dim model).',
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'Platform adapter fails on real data',
|
||||
'Medium',
|
||||
'Medium',
|
||||
'Each adapter has unit tests on fixture data. If real data diverges from fixtures, capture the failing sample as a new fixture and patch the adapter. Partial ingestion is acceptable (log errors, continue).',
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'Performance degrades at 100K frames',
|
||||
'Low',
|
||||
'Medium',
|
||||
'SQLite WAL + sqlite-vec are designed for this scale. If p95 exceeds threshold, profile the query plan (EXPLAIN QUERY PLAN), add covering indexes, or implement frame archival (move old frames to a cold table).',
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'Dedup false positives (unique frames deleted)',
|
||||
'Low',
|
||||
'High',
|
||||
'Dedup is conservative by design (SHA-256 exact + trigram threshold 0.85). If false positives occur, raise the similarity threshold. All dedup is reversible (original items retained in source_store).',
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'LLM judge inconsistency (alpha < 0.40)',
|
||||
'Low',
|
||||
'Medium',
|
||||
'Re-design the scoring rubric with more specific criteria. Add calibration examples. If one judge is an outlier, drop it and report 3-judge results.',
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'Budget overrun (> $500)',
|
||||
'Low',
|
||||
'Low',
|
||||
'Monitor cumulative spend after each step. Steps 2\u20133 are the most expensive (embedding + judge). If on track to exceed, reduce query set from 100 to 50 and note reduced statistical power.',
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'Competitor system (mem0/Letta) API changes',
|
||||
'Medium',
|
||||
'Low',
|
||||
'Pin exact versions of mem0 and Letta SDKs in the test harness. If API breaks, document the failure and compare against the remaining baselines.',
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'Compliance checker false positive',
|
||||
'Low',
|
||||
'Medium',
|
||||
'Cross-reference programmatic check against manual SQL queries on the ai_interactions table. The manual check is the ground truth.',
|
||||
],
|
||||
],
|
||||
),
|
||||
pageBreak(),
|
||||
];
|
||||
}
